The Whale Museum (TWM) in Friday Harbor, WA, is holding an exciting virtual 
Gear Down Workshop for Marine Naturalists this fall on Friday, November 18. 
This workshop will be held from 10:00 am to 5:00 pm Pacific Time and 
registrants will join sessions through the videoconferencing platform, Zoom. 
The theme of this “Gear Down” Workshop will be Ocean Sounds: New Discoveries!


Invited presenters include:

  *   Elizabeth Ferguson, Ocean Science Analytics, on how artificial 
intelligence (DeepSqueak) is being used to detect underwater marine mammal 
vocalizations
  *   Dr. Jason Wood, SMRU Consulting, on acoustic monitoring of cetaceans in 
the Salish Sea
  *   Dr. Victoria Warren and Dr. Katie Kowarski, JASCO Applied Sciences, on 
humpback whale songs
  *   Caitlin O’Morchoe, Washington Maritime Blue, on an update of Quiet Sound
And
  *   Madison Wilson, California State University Fullerton, on how baleen 
whales hear
